diff options
-rwxr-xr-x | jenkins-builds/funcs_promotion.sh | 8 | ||||
-rwxr-xr-x | jenkins-builds/promote-latest-builds.sh | 2 | ||||
-rw-r--r-- | jenkins-server-slave-setup/arm-linux/ubuntu-linux-arm.txt | 68 | ||||
-rw-r--r-- | jenkins-server-slave-setup/cygwin-sshd/FAQ.txt | 16 |
4 files changed, 89 insertions, 5 deletions
diff --git a/jenkins-builds/funcs_promotion.sh b/jenkins-builds/funcs_promotion.sh index 87b780c..840391a 100755 --- a/jenkins-builds/funcs_promotion.sh +++ b/jenkins-builds/funcs_promotion.sh @@ -281,13 +281,13 @@ function prom_promote_demos() { echo "ERROR: No 7z file for module $module, sdir $sourcedir" exit 1 fi - cp -av $sfile $zfile local sfolder=`basename $sfile .7z` - local zfolder=`basename $zfile .7z` - echo "INFO: extract $module - $zfile -> tmp/$zfolder" + local zfolder=$module + echo "INFO: extract $module - $sfile -> tmp/$zfolder" cd tmp - prom_extract ../$zfile $sfolder + prom_extract ../$sfile $sfolder mv -v $sfolder $zfolder + 7z a -r ../$zfile $zfolder cd .. if $fromslave ; then prom_verify_artifacts $module log/$module.artifact.properties tmp/$zfolder/artifact.properties diff --git a/jenkins-builds/promote-latest-builds.sh b/jenkins-builds/promote-latest-builds.sh index 677cf9e..adb21e6 100755 --- a/jenkins-builds/promote-latest-builds.sh +++ b/jenkins-builds/promote-latest-builds.sh @@ -34,7 +34,7 @@ logfile=$thisdir/`basename $0 .sh`.log archivedir=/srv/www/jogamp.org/deployment/archive/$branch rootdir=/srv/www/jogamp.org/deployment/autobuilds/$branch -os_and_archs_minus_one="linux-i586 macosx-universal windows-amd64 windows-i586 solaris-i586 solaris-amd64" +os_and_archs_minus_one="linux-i586 linux-armv7 macosx-universal windows-amd64 windows-i586 solaris-i586 solaris-amd64" masterpick="linux-amd64" os_and_archs="$masterpick $os_and_archs_minus_one" diff --git a/jenkins-server-slave-setup/arm-linux/ubuntu-linux-arm.txt b/jenkins-server-slave-setup/arm-linux/ubuntu-linux-arm.txt new file mode 100644 index 0000000..48d96c3 --- /dev/null +++ b/jenkins-server-slave-setup/arm-linux/ubuntu-linux-arm.txt @@ -0,0 +1,68 @@ + +# Pandaboard (TI Omap4, SGX 540) +https://wiki.ubuntu.com/ARM/OMAP +https://wiki.ubuntu.com/ARM/OMAP/Graphics + +(openmax? + try the https://launchpad.net/~tiomap-dev/+archive/omap-trunk instead of the https://launchpad.net/~tiomap-dev/+archive/release) + +# Toshiba AC100 (NV Tegra2) +https://wiki.ubuntu.com/ARM/TEGRA/AC100#Installing_Ubuntu_11.10_on_the_AC100 +https://launchpad.net/ubuntu/+source/nvidia-graphics-drivers-tegra/ + +#install openjdk, ant/junit and rsync/mesa-utils-extra +# +apt-get install openjdk-6-jdk openjdk-6-jre openjdk-6-jre-headless openjdk-6-jre-lib icedtea-6-jre-cacao icedtea-6-jre-jamvm icedtea-netx icedtea-plugin \ + ant junit \ + rsync mesa-utils-extra + +#install and use openbox windowmanager! +apt-get install openbox obconf + +Disable GLX: + +/etc/X11/xorg.conf: + # Disable GLX extension, DRI* is usually required even for EGL + Section "Module" + # Disable "dri" + # Disable "dri2" + Disable "glx" + EndSection + +Package / Service / Module Removal: + +dpkg -P zeitgeist zeitgeist-extension-fts unity-lens-applications unity-lens-files +dpkg -P zeitgeist-core zeitgeist-datahub rhythmbox-plugins libzeitgeist-1.0-1 + +vi /etc/network/interfaces + auto lo eth0 + iface lo inet loopback + + allow-hotplug eth0 + iface eth0 inet dhcp + +update-rc.d -f network-manager remove +dpkg -P network-manager network-manager-gnome + +update-rc.d -f cups remove +dpkg -P cups hplip hplip-cups bluez-cups cups-driver-gutenprint + +vi /etc/modprobe.d/blacklist.conf + blacklist wl12xx_sdio + blacklist wl12xx + blacklist bnep + blacklist rfcomm + blacklist bluetooth + blacklist fuse + blacklist wl12xx + blacklist mac80211 + blacklist cfg80211 + blacklist rfkill + blacklist st_drv + blacklist joydev + blacklist btwilink + blacklist btrfs + +update-rc.d -f bluetooth remove + +dpkg -P rtkit diff --git a/jenkins-server-slave-setup/cygwin-sshd/FAQ.txt b/jenkins-server-slave-setup/cygwin-sshd/FAQ.txt new file mode 100644 index 0000000..188c986 --- /dev/null +++ b/jenkins-server-slave-setup/cygwin-sshd/FAQ.txt @@ -0,0 +1,16 @@ +How to update cygwin /etc/passwd to get all latest windoze users + +mkpasswd -cl > /etc/passwd + +mkgroup --local > /etc/group + ++++++++++++ + +http://www.howtogeek.com/howto/windows-vista/enable-the-hidden-administrator-account-on-windows-vista/ + +Enable Built-in Administrator Account / start dos-shell 'run-as-admin': + net user administrator /active:yes + ++++++ + + |